Types of spells protection
« on: April 11, 2024, 08:16:52 PM »
In a world filled with unseen energies and forces, protection spells stand as a beacon of defense against negative influences, psychic attacks, and malevolent entities. From ancient traditions to modern occult practices, these spells encompass a diverse array of techniques and rituals aimed at safeguarding individuals, spaces, and possessions. In this exploration, we will delve into the various types of protection spells and their significance in the realm of magic.
1. Warding Spells
Warding spells are perhaps the most fundamental form of protection magic, designed to create energetic barriers around individuals or spaces to repel negative influences. These spells often involve the visualization of a protective shield or the invocation of spiritual guardians to stand watch over the protected area. Warding rituals may incorporate physical objects such as talismans, amulets, or protective sigils to enhance their efficacy.
2. Banishing Spells
Banishing spells are employed to remove unwanted energies, entities, or influences from a person, place, or object. Whether it's clearing a space of negative vibrations, breaking a psychic attachment, or banishing malevolent spirits, these spells operate on the principle of expulsion and purification. Banishing rituals may involve the use of sacred herbs, incantations, or ceremonial tools to facilitate the removal of unwanted energies and restore balance and harmony.
3. Psychic Protection Spells
Psychic protection spells focus on shielding individuals from psychic attacks, intrusive thoughts, and energetic manipulation. These spells are particularly relevant for empaths, psychics, and sensitive individuals who may be more susceptible to external influences. Psychic protection rituals often incorporate visualization techniques, energetic shields, and psychic self-defense practices to strengthen the individual's aura and ward off psychic intrusions.
4. Home Protection Spells
Home protection spells are aimed at safeguarding the household and its inhabitants from negative energies, malevolent spirits, and psychic disturbances. These spells may involve the blessing of the home, the placement of protective charms or talismans, and the invocation of household deities or guardian spirits. Home protection rituals are often performed during times of transition, such as moving into a new residence or after experiencing disturbances in the home environment.
5. Personal Protection Spells
Personal protection spells are tailored to the individual, offering defense against physical harm, psychic attacks, and spiritual disturbances. These spells may involve the creation of personal talismans or amulets, the casting of protective circles, or the invocation of personal guardian spirits. Personal protection rituals empower individuals to take an active role in safeguarding their well-being and cultivating resilience in the face of adversity.
6. Elemental Protection Spells
Elemental protection spells harness the elemental energies of earth, air, fire, and water to provide holistic protection and balance. These spells may involve the invocation of elemental guardians, the use of elemental correspondences in ritual work, or the creation of elemental sigils to imbue objects with protective energies. Elemental protection rituals honor the natural elements as sources of strength and resilience, aligning the practitioner with the primal forces of creation and destruction.
Conclusion
Protection spells serve as a vital tool in the magician's arsenal, offering defense against unseen threats and negative influences in the physical, psychic, and spiritual realms. Whether warding off malevolent spirits, banishing unwanted energies, or creating psychic shields, these spells empower individuals to assert their sovereignty and maintain energetic integrity in a world fraught with challenges and uncertainties. By understanding the various types of protection spells and incorporating them into their magical practice, practitioners can cultivate a sense of safety, empowerment, and resilience in their lives.

Two Powerful Recipes for Effective Protection Spells

An in-depth guide to crafting, casting, and empowering magical shields

Protection magic has existed for as long as humans have feared the unknown. Whether used to guard a home, cleanse a space, or shield one’s inner life from emotional turbulence, protection spells remain among the most universal forms of magic. They appear in folklore from every continent, practiced by sages, herbalists, mystics, and ordinary people seeking a sense of safety.

This article explores two comprehensive, fully developed protection spell recipes, each crafted to be approachable for beginners yet powerful enough for seasoned practitioners. These spells do not rely on any particular religious or cultural tradition. Instead, they blend symbolic logic, elemental associations, and intentional energy work in ways that are adaptable to many worldviews.

Before exploring the spells themselves, let us set essential groundwork so that your practice is rooted in clarity and purpose rather than guesswork.

Understanding the Essence of Protection Magic

Protection magic has three fundamental goals:

Deflection – repelling harmful energies or influences.

Cleansing – dissolving lingering negativity or emotional residue.

Fortification – strengthening your energetic boundaries and reinforcing your personal power.

A well-constructed spell blends all three, ensuring that your protection isn’t merely a wall but an active, responsive system.

Protection can be metaphoric, psychological, or spiritual. Even if you do not literally believe in “energy,” the ritual acts serve as symbolic anchors that help the mind feel more grounded and resilient. Many people discover that protection spells function as:

mindfulness tools

confidence boosters

emotional reset mechanisms

intentional statements of personal boundaries

In this article’s two recipes, you’ll find these principles woven throughout the steps.

Recipe 1: The Salt & Flame Circle — A Classic Space-Clearing Protection Spell

This spell is ideal for cleansing a room or home, breaking up stagnant energy, or creating a temporary shield around a space during difficult periods. It works well before sleep, during stressful times, or before major life changes.

Ingredients

A bowl of coarse salt (sea salt or rock salt)

One candle (white for general protection; black for banishing)

Matches or a lighter

A heat-safe surface

A small cup of water (optional but recommended)

A fireproof dish for safety

Why These Ingredients?

Salt is one of the oldest protective elements on Earth—symbolizing purity, durability, and grounding.

Flame represents illumination, transformation, and the ability to burn away obstacles.

Water acts as the emotional buffer that stabilizes the other elements.

Together, these materials form a balanced energetic triad.

Step-by-Step Instructions
1. Prepare the Space

Begin by cleaning the room lightly—tidying clutter or opening a window for a moment. This physical reset strengthens the ritual’s intention.

Place the salt bowl in front of you and the unlit candle beside it.

Take a slow breath and say:

“I clear this space. I release what is not mine and welcome only what supports me.”

2. Pour a Circle of Salt

Slowly pour a thin line of salt around the candle, forming a protective circle. Move clockwise for drawing protective energy inward; counterclockwise if your intent is banishment.

As you pour, imagine the circle glowing softly. Visualize it as a boundary that unwanted influences cannot cross.

3. Light the Candle

Strike the match with intent—not rushed, not careless. Light the candle and focus on the flame.

Say aloud or silently:

“With this flame, I illuminate truth. With this circle, I claim safety.”

The candle flame symbolizes vigilance and clarity. Watch how it dances—steady flames indicate a calm environment, while flickering flames may suggest active shifts in the surrounding energy.

4. Seal the Protection

Dip a finger into the cup of water and lightly touch your forehead or the rim of the salt bowl.

Say:

“Salt, flame, and water—stand guard.
Shield this space from harm.
Only clarity, peace, and strength may enter.”

Take several breaths before extinguishing the candle (or let it burn safely if you prefer).

5. Dispose of the Salt

After the ritual, do not reuse the salt. Sweep it up and throw it away outdoors or into running water. Symbolically, this represents the removal of whatever negativity the salt absorbed.

When to Use This Spell

Before meditation or spiritual practices

After conflict or tension in a space

During transitional times (new job, breakup, move)

Whenever you feel “heavy” energy in a room

This recipe is direct, simple, and extremely effective for environmental protection.

Recipe 2: The Iron & Herb Charm Bag — A Long-Term Personal Protection Spell

Where the first spell protects a place, the second protects a person. This charm is portable, durable, and excellent for emotional protection, boundary-setting, or spiritual shielding.

Ingredients

A small cloth pouch (preferably black, white, or deep blue)

A small piece of iron (a nail, washer, or key works)

Protective herbs, such as:

rosemary (clarity and purification)

sage (banishing negativity)

bay leaf (protection and strength)

lavender (calming protection)

A marker or ribbon to seal the charm

Optional: a small crystal such as obsidian, hematite, or smoky quartz

Symbolic Significance

Iron has long been believed to repel harmful forces—fairies, nightmares, curses, and intrusive energies in various mythologies.

Herbs carry vibrational or symbolic associations recognized across cultures.

The pouch creates a container for focused intention.

Step-by-Step Instructions
1. Activate the Iron

Hold the iron object in both hands. Picture it becoming heavy, grounded, and immovable—symbolizing unwavering protection.

Say:

“Iron of Earth, steadfast and strong,
Be my shield against all wrong.”

2. Add Herbs With Purpose

Place each herb into the pouch one by one. As you do, assign each one a role:

Rosemary: “For clarity and peace.”

Sage: “For banishing what drains me.”

Bay: “For strength in my choices.”

Lavender: “For calm in my heart.”

Be slow and deliberate. This step builds the inner architecture of the spell.

3. Combine and Awaken the Charm

Place the iron into the pouch last. Close the bag but do not tie it yet.

Hold it to your chest and breathe deeply. Imagine a sphere of protective energy forming around you, anchored by the charm.

Whisper:

“Guard me as I walk my path.
Let no harm cling to me.
Let my spirit stay whole and steady.”

4. Seal the Bag

Tie the ribbon or pull the drawstring tight.

Once sealed, do not open the charm bag again. Opening it disperses the energy. If you ever feel it has absorbed too much negativity, you may respectfully dismantle and rebuild it with fresh ingredients.

5. Carry or Store the Charm

You may:

keep it in a pocket

place it in your bag

hide it under your pillow

hang it near your front door

store it in your desk at work

Over time, many people find they can “feel” the charm’s subtle presence—almost like a steadying hand on the shoulder.

Enhancements and Variations
1. Add a Personal Element

A strand of hair, a tiny note, or a symbol drawn on a slip of paper can help personalize the charm.

2. Charge Under Moonlight

A full or new moon can amplify protective spells, depending on tradition. You may place the charm or salt circle tools near a window overnight.

3. Use Breathwork

Your breath is one of the strongest sources of personal energy. Slow exhalations during each step reinforce the spell’s potency.

4. Combine Both Spells

Using the Salt & Flame Circle to cleanse a space and the Iron & Herb Charm Bag to protect yourself creates a powerful layered defense—one external, one internal.
